Biggest windbg pet peeve

What is your biggest pet peeve related to the windbg debugger from microsoft? (note: I actually really like windbg if I ignore the unpolished UI.)

The ridiculous behavior when you attempt to use click-drag to select text on a line that is wider than its physical window. The pieces of the history window that I need to copy/paste into bug reports are frequently wider than the physical window.

I've gotten so used to the triple-click workaround that I find myself attempting to misuse triple click in other (well behaved) applications.

Key presses are ignored while the focus is in a source window.

It's not like you can edit the source code from inside windbg.

At least there's the Alt-1 workaround.

How insanely slow .kdfiles copies new binaries across the 1394 connection.

It can take up to one minute for a large dll.

Attempting to dock a window is almost always the wrong kind of dock the first time until :I move the mouse just right.

Why can't it have the docking cues that VS2008 has?
